Essential Duties and Responsibilities include the following and other duties may be assigned:
· Test all electrical equipment that returns from the field
· Assist field teams to diagnose and fix electrical issues remotely
· Keep electrical work area clean and organized
· Follow sets of instructions/designs to fabricate electrical assemblies
· Follow technical guides to help integrate new products into the equipment fleet
· Communicate with Shop Manager of needs and/or challenges
· Can perform routine maintenance on vehicles, to include 1-ton diesel trucks
· Can perform routine maintenance on enclosed cargo trailer
· Can diagnose issues with road vehicles/trailers
· Assist in mechanical repairs to the ROV and robot fleet. Work, build, and repair PLCs, motor controllers, tethers, control boxes.
· General mechanical skills to help in other areas (i.e. robot maintenance) when needed
· Help develop processes & procedures regarding the use of ROV and robotic equipment
